2020-5-5·An instantaneous gas hot water unit (instant gas hot water system) is a tankless hot water heater that warms the water as it passes through a serpentine heat exchanger at a flow rate of 10 to 32 litres per minute, whilst providing a virtually endless supply of hot water. Instantaneous gas hot water unit prices are in the $1200 to $1575 range, depending on flow rate.

Get a QuoteA gas hot water boiler is less energy efficient than an electric hot water boiler, but the cost of electricity itself makes the running costs of an electric hot water boiler higher. Gas hot water boilers also have a much faster recovery rate, which makes them a suitable choice for larger families.

Get a QuoteThe initial cost increase for a condensing hot water boiler system doesnt necessarily stop at the boiler, as equipment selection is different based on using lower hot water supply and return temperatures. The most common change is the physical size and associated cost of the hot water coils in the system.

Get a QuoteSteam Boiler vs Hot Water Boiler - ATI of NY. In contrast, a hot water boiler will typically require an expansion tank, a circulator, and a flow check valve. Most importantly, a hot water boiler will require a motorized pump. Cost of Implementation. The cost associated with steam boiler vs hot water boilers are approximately the same.

Get a QuoteIn general, the cost for a lower pressure boiler feed water treatment system (using properly pretreated water) can run you about $50,000$100,000 at 100 GPM for equipment, $100,000$250,000 if you need a softener and dealkalizer.
